What makes me most dissatisfied in "Sin City 2" is the characterization of Ma Fu. Of course, apart from the content, "Sin City 2" still has a lot of beauty in terms of form.

The beauty of the picture: "Sin City 2" still uses a lot of black and white contrast to describe the characteristics of the space, which makes the movie retain the same feeling as the comics, and the appropriate use of bright colors can make the characters more vivid, although a little abrupt. . For example, Eva Green’s red lips and blue eyes strongly and intuitively express Ava’s mood swings, not only can highlight the character’s viciousness and ghosts, but also make Eva’s sexy performance more heartily.

The beauty of the lens: In addition to the characters, "Sin City 2" uses a lot of virtual scene shooting methods in the shooting of the environment. The extensive use of computer special effects in the later period makes the lens more exaggerated and expressive. When the audience is watching Can be infected by extreme expressions. Especially those undisguised "pornography" and unmodified "violence."

The beauty of language: There are very few dialogues in "Sin City 2", instead a lot of monologues. This design gives the film a little more literary temperament. Especially the inner monologue of the characters, although the rhythm is slow, it clearly explains the direction of the whole story and the psychological changes of the characters. This intensity can make people feel the helplessness and sadness in the city of sin.
